Smoothping is an open source monitoring tool that pings network hosts periodically and graphs latency and packet loss. It provides colorful visual reports that help identify network issues.
Battleping is a gaming network monitoring tool that provides real-time analysis of connection quality between a player's computer and game servers. It tracks latency, packet loss, and jitter to help identify issues impacting game performance and online gameplay.
